Your travels will always be smooth and rewarding when you slip on the long-sleeve Backcountry.com Destination T-Shirt and take on the world with an opened mind.
  • Dri-Release polyester and cotton blend fabric provide quick-drying, breathable, and smooth performance for any hike, ride, or day under the sun
  • Built-in Freshguard Antimicrobial prevents the build-up of odor-causing microbes so you stay smelling good after weeks of trekking

As others have said, this is a fitted long sleeve that was instantly a favorite of mine for outdoor recreation. The dri-release blend fabric not only breathes and dries well, it won't shrink. The fact that this shirt keeps its shape is important because I particularly like the fit. I'm 6'4", 190 lbs, with long arms. This shirt in size XL fits me perfectly. I also like the teal-ish blue/green color and the clean graphic print on the front.

Got this and immediately added it to the rotation of lightweight synthetic shirts. It's light enough to wear in warmer temps for some sun/ brush protection, and thin/ low profile enough to not bunch up when layering. Sizing is a little weird, but not a huge issue. I'm 6'1", 210lbs and usually wear a large in short and long sleeve shirts. I found that the large in this shirt was a little tight in the chest and especially in the arms (fine in the shoulders/ armpits, but sleeves were tight). Swapped for an XL and it fits great. Long enough to tuck in if I'm layering, but not mumu-length. Also, sleeve length is great - I generally find generic cotton L/S shirts to be a smidge short, but this shirt is right on the money without going too long
